Sri Lanka is a beautiful island nation located in the Indian Ocean, like a tear-shaped island. It's not very big but known for its stunning beaches, lush green landscapes, and rich cultural heritage.

Sigiriya: Sigiriya is a UNESCO World Heritage site and one of Sri Lanka's most iconic landmarks. It's known for the ancient rock fortress built on top of a massive rock column. Visitors can explore beautifully landscaped gardens and ancient frescoes on their way to the top.

Kandy: Kandy is a historic city nestled amidst lush green hills. It's famous for the Temple of the Tooth Relic, a significant Buddhist pilgrimage site. The picturesque Kandy Lake and the Royal Botanical Gardens are other attractions.

Nuwara Eliya: Often referred to as "Little England," Nuwara Eliya is a charming hill station. It's known for its cool climate, rolling hills, and tea plantations. You can visit a tea factory, take scenic train rides, and explore beautiful gardens.

Bentota: Bentota is a coastal town known for its beautiful beaches and water sports. It's a great place for relaxation and water activities like jet skiing, snorkeling, and windsurfing. Bentota also has lush mangrove forests, making it a haven for nature enthusiasts.

Colombo: Colombo is the capital city of Sri Lanka and its economic and cultural hub. It offers a mix of modern and historic attractions. The city is known for its vibrant street food and bustling markets.

After Breakfast at 08.30 AM, visit the Sigiriya. Sigiriya is the 5th Century ‘Fortress in the Sky,” which is perhaps the most fantastic single wonder of the Island. It is also known as Lion Rock because of the huge lion that used to stand at the entrance to the fortress. Within its triple-moated defense, the huge rock rises almost to a sheer height of 500ft. On its summit are the foundations of what was once a great and sumptuous palace and gardens, complete with a swimming pool. On one of the stairways, the only known ancient work of Sinhala secular painting survived in the form of frescoes of life-sized damsels in all the freshness and delicacy of their original color. Located in the backwoods of the North Central Province is home to the famous Minneriya National Park that shelters some of the greatest wildlife treasures of this paradise isle. The park, nourished by an ancient man-made tank, provides shelter for troupes of toque monkeys and sambar deer as well as leopards, elephants, and bird flocks, including little cormorants and painted storks, to name a few.It is also renowned for the ‘Sixth Greatest Wildlife Spectacle of the World’ – the amazing phenomenon of the ‘Minneriya Elephant gathering.’ The best time to visit the park is during June – September, as the low water levels of the tank expose grass in the tank bed, which attracts herds of grazing animals. After breakfast, transfer to Kandy. En route, visit the Dambulla cave temple & Spice Garden. Dambulla is famous for the five cave Temples on a rock. The first 03 caves are better, older, and larger than the others. Some caves date to 1st C.B.C. All 5 cave walls and ceilings are covered with Buddhist murals, and there are more than 130 Buddha statues; statues of Gods and Kings are also found here. Spice garden where you can touch and feel various organic herbs and spices. Evening enjoy Kandy city tour Kandy City tour The hill capital of Sri Lanka; Kandy, was decl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1988. Not only is it a beautiful city surrounded by mountains, but it is also home to significant historical and religious attractions such as the Temple of the Tooth Relic. Kandy Lake Kandy Lake is an excellent place for people to watch in the shade of the ancient trees. Go for a walk with your travel buddy. One of the unique aspects of Kandy is its laidback streets. Full of a colorful kaleidoscope of a colonial building house. Temple of the Tooth Relic Explore the sacred temple of the Tooth Relic, a historic location of both cultural and religious significance. The Temple of the Tooth Relic is the jewel in the heart of the old city, captivating and majestic. It is a greatly venerated site as the place that holds the Tooth Relic of the Buddha and thus attracts pilgrims from all over the world and the island. Check-in Hotel and Relax. After Breakfast enjoy the Bentota City tour, and the Madu river Boat Ride - The bio-diversity of the Madu River is of monumental signification when considering the wide ranges of aquatic and avian life as well as wetland dwelling amphibians, reptiles, and mammals that inhabit the environs of this natural treasure. A total of 11 species of agnatic mollusks and 14 land-dwelling mollusks are found in this system. 70 species of fish, 31 types of reptiles, and 50 kinds of butterflies are just some of the colorful array of wildlife that inhabits this abundantly bustling eco-system. Bird watchers will be pleased to know that 111 species of bird have been identified in the mangrove-formed environs of the river, and have been known to host several types of migratory birds.
